What argument is Georges Clemenceau, the French premier, making in this statement? Napoleon was the finest general in French his

tory. France is far safer than either Britain or the United States. France has far more to fear from a strong Germany than either the United States or Britain. The war caused more damage to French property than to British or American property.

Answer:

France has far more to fear from a strong Germany than either the United States or Britain.

Explanation:

Clemenceau argued that the Germans would have done the same thing to Britain and France if they had won the war. He believed that France would never be safe unless Germany was crippled. In his view, Germany should be forced to pay large amounts in reparations to Belgium and France.
